Transaction 39372e2eb5172b611304096add553656d0263e428e48bc81578fb6f8c0aeaefd
1 Input
1 Output
-
39372e2eb5172b611304096add553656d0263e428e48bc81578fb6f8c0aeaefd:0
- value
- 35294341
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e387c7872fb94d79e1928cd172b7885033be3930 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mk53fWuWkA57gwnDU57bdtG3vou1YL6AZ